Mom and Pop RV Park in Farmington, NM

So we were drifting into Farmington, NM after a beautiful drive at 9000 feet through the mountains north west of Santa Fe and we needed a campground. Bradley pulled out Paddie (we call the iPad Paddie) and quickly found a campground that had Wifi. The boys won't stay at a campground that does not have Wifi.

We called ahead and confirmed an empty spot for us and checked prices. But when we drove past it we all agreed we did not want to stay there. So we drove on into the setting sun.

Next we spotted Mom and Pop's RV Park and turned in. It was a wise decision. Pop retired from the Air Force in 1981 and he and his wife full timed for a while at sometime in their lives. One time when he was in Boston he picked up some toy lead molds at a flea market and discovered he had a knack for making molds of small toys and figures, filling them with molten lead and then painting them.

His whole office was filled with painted lead figures. He had individual parts or complete scenes like hangings, Indian gatherings, cattle roundups, signing of the Declaration of Independence, ancient Europe battle scenes, etc. It was wild.

He also had an outdoor train with complete scenes from the American west, the 1920's, etc.

He was a joy to talk to. He only accepted cash and I think he stuffed it into a drawer. He sold nothing else in the office except his toys.

And the finishing touch for this campground was the parrot on top of a camper. We all agreed this was a good stop.
